Transaction dfb14c7522e7a698109c2d03bd3bdd000efd7e28cafae86e6754d569ede9a891
1 Input
1 Output
-
dfb14c7522e7a698109c2d03bd3bdd000efd7e28cafae86e6754d569ede9a891:0
- value
- 1486217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2dc3e6553579c4dd63e46ec35c4e822dd1d32ea2 OP_EQUAL
- address
- 35s11XcCG613RVHHeEkU5htbDV8qLDffra